The landscape was like a painting, the setting sun like blood.
Lu Yang stood on the sea of clouds. After a long while, no palm strike descended from the sky to pulverize him, and only then did he breathe a sigh of relief.
"Was that... a Foundation Establishment Perfected Being?"
Lu Yang didn't even dare to mutter to himself, thinking it over in his mind. His expression was as grim as it could be; the gap between them was simply too vast.
Not just his body, but even his thoughts had been frozen. He only reacted after Daoist Hongyun had left. The feeling was like a mouse caught by a cat—it was no longer a mere difference in power, but a distinction in level, instantly extinguishing all the arrogance in Lu Yang's heart.
"I'm still too weak, without power."
Originally, after defeating Liu Xin and the others against the odds, Lu Yang had swept away the gloom of his past life, feeling spirited and triumphant. Now, however, his mindset had leveled out once more.
The path of cultivation is long; one must still strive forward.
Lu Yang sighed with emotion, then recalled the matter of Xiao Shiye, a look of fear appearing in his eyes again. "Destiny... can it actually be bestowed by others?"
He remembered it now.
Before heading to the Merit Pool, Xiao Shiye had said something: "It just so happens I've been quite lucky recently, so I wanted to take the chance to try my luck."
Lucky recently.
At the time, Lu Yang had only thought it was the humility of a Son of Heaven's Mandate, but now it seemed that might have been the truth. He really had only just recently become lucky.
Because of that Daoist Hongyun!
"The colored fish in the Merit Pool must be the Colored Merit Fish. Daoist Hongyun wants to use Xiao Shiye to fish it out of the Merit Pool?"
"If that's true, then he succeeded in my past life. But speaking of which, after fishing out the Colored Merit Fish in the last life, Xiao Shiye announced he was entering seclusion and was never heard from again." Lu Yang felt a chill run down his spine. Fishing, fishing... once the fish is caught, is the bait no longer needed?
At this thought, Lu Yang suddenly looked up.
The Primal Saint Sect, the Heaven-Connecting Cloud Sea.
Perhaps to the elusive higher-ups of the Saint Sect, these so-called disciples were just a school of fish being raised in a pond?
"As expected of the Saint Sect..."
Lu Yang took a deep breath, beginning to understand why no one had slapped him to death.
So what if a little fish jumped around a bit more energetically and had some unspeakable secrets? They might even think you're a talent!
"In any case, at least the secret of the [Book of a Hundred Lives] wasn't exposed." Lu Yang felt fortunate. Not only that, but the karma related to the book seemed to have been hidden from Perfected Being Hongyun as well, so much so that the man hadn't suspected a thing about how he'd reached the fourth level of Qi Refining before even joining the sect.
"No time to waste. I should head back first."
Fortunately, although the *Innate Dao Scripture* was taken away by Daoist Hongyun, Lu Yang had already memorized its entire contents.
This was a good habit Lu Yang had developed because of the [Book of a Hundred Lives].
Whenever he encountered a decent cultivation method or divine ability, he would immediately memorize it. That way, he could use it in his next life without needing to spend contribution points to redeem it again.
Moreover, Daoist Hongyun had taken the *Innate Dao Scripture*, but he hadn't taken Fairy Qingchen's *Secret Explanation of Arrays and Treasures*.
"Admittedly, the two are not comparable in the slightest. Fairy Qingchen's work is clearly not worthy of that person's notice... but for me, it is of great use."
In truth, Lu Yang didn't place much importance on the *Innate Dao Scripture*. He had already set his sights on Zhao Xuhe's third-grade true technique. The *Innate Dao Scripture* was optional, but he was very interested in cultivation skills like the *Secret Explanation of Arrays and Treasures*, which involved array formation and treasure refining.
As for the Innate Primal Qi Myriad Spirits Banner...
"There will always be a chance. We'll see about it in the next life."
Returning to his grotto-mansion, Lu Yang patiently settled down to cultivate, studying the *Secret Explanation of Arrays and Treasures* while slowly repairing the damage to his Sword Pellet.
It wasn't until half a month later that he emerged from seclusion once more.
This time, he sought out Zhao Xuhe.
But when he arrived at Zhao Xuhe's grotto-mansion, he saw Zhao Xuhe arguing with a stern-looking young man dressed in the uniform of the Law Enforcement Hall.
"Senior Brother, believe me! Don't you know my, Zhao Xuhe's, reputation? It's been excellent for over a decade. It's just 1000 contribution points, I'll definitely pay it back... What? Interest!? You... Fine, no problem. Senior Brother, just give me a few more days, and I'll definitely pay it back with interest."
After they argued for a moment, the disciple from the Law Enforcement Hall left with a cold smile.
Zhao Xuhe, on the other hand, stood there with a gloomy face, the Qi around him fluctuating unstably. Seeing that the time was right, Lu Yang immediately appeared and walked over.
"Senior Brother Zhao, long time no see."
Zhao Xuhe looked up at the sound of his voice and instantly noticed Lu Yang's undisguised Qi. His pupils shrank. "Junior Brother Lu... you've broken through to the late stage of Qi Refining!?"
"Just a stroke of luck."
Lu Yang smiled faintly. "My aptitude is poor. I spent several months in seclusion and used up quite a few contribution points to have this lucky breakthrough. I've made a fool of myself in front of you, Senior Brother."
Hearing this, Zhao Xuhe's expression grew even stiffer, almost twisting. After all, they had both speculated on the Death-Substituting Yin Puppets. He had lost his entire fortune and even his mistress had left him for someone else, while Lu Yang had made a fortune and even used the contribution points he earned to break through to the late stage of Qi Refining.
What was even more infuriating was that he might not even be Lu Yang's match now!
"Although I obtained Perfected Being Panlong's opportunity, because my destiny was insufficient and my merit lacking, I only managed to get half of that third-grade true technique..."
He had even specifically asked his master about this.
His master had divined the karma and concluded that it was because he had speculated on the Death-Substituting Yin Puppets, prematurely exhausting the merit he had accumulated over three lifetimes, which led to his failure at the last moment.
At this thought, Zhao Xuhe nearly ground his teeth to dust.
Half a third-grade true technique, with only the Qi Refining Realm's *Nine Transformations of the Dragon Art* but missing the Foundation Establishment part, was completely useless to him!
Not to mention he was now in debt. He didn't even dare to disperse his cultivation to switch techniques, fearing that a debt collector would show up during the transition, see him powerless after dispersing his skills, and instantly turn into a robber, plundering him clean before silencing him forever. Then he would truly have nowhere to voice his grievances.
"Junior Brother, is there something you need from me?"
"It's a long story." Lu Yang sighed. "To be honest, Senior Brother, I've come seeking your guidance. I've run into some trouble recently."
"Trouble?" Zhao Xuhe's eyes lit up.
Lu Yang sighed in response. "I was previously focused solely on cultivation. It wasn't until I broke through to the late stage of Qi Refining that I learned about the issue of True Qi grades. I'm filled with regret..."
Hearing Lu Yang say this, Zhao Xuhe suddenly felt much better.
"So it's about the grade of your True Qi."
Zhao Xuhe offered some hypocritical words of comfort. "Most disciples in the Saint Sect are actually unaware of this, so it's normal that you didn't know, Junior Brother."
"Alas, life is unpredictable." Lu Yang shook his head helplessly. "That's why I've come to you this time, Senior Brother. I wanted to ask if there's any way to raise the grade of my True Qi. It would be even better if there's a superior cultivation method... As for the price, you don't need to worry. I can still afford one or two thousand contribution points."
"...Oh?"
Hearing Lu Yang's words, Zhao Xuhe's mind immediately started racing. One or two thousand contribution points... that was exactly the sum he urgently needed right now.
In a flash, Zhao Xuhe's thoughts spun, and he suddenly said:
"Junior Brother Lu, if you put it that way... I actually do have a technique on hand that's suitable for you. As long as you cultivate it, you can definitely raise the grade of your True Qi."
"Really?" Lu Yang's face filled with anticipation. "What technique is it?"
Zhao Xuhe hesitated, feeling a strange sense of unease for some reason. But on second thought, he only had half of the technique; it was already useless.
Rather than keeping it, it was better to make use of this waste and pay off his debts.
At this thought, Zhao Xuhe gritted his teeth and took out the *Nine Transformations of the Dragon Art* he had obtained from Coiling Dragon Island, handing it to Lu Yang.
